Cannabis is grown from one of two sources: a seed or a clone. Seeds bring genetic information from two parent plants and can express many different combinations of qualities: some from the mother, some from the dad, and some characteristics from both. In industrial cannabis production, typically, growers will plant many seeds of one stress and select the very best plant. They will then take clones from that individual plant, which permits for consistent genes for mass production. autoflower marijuana seeds. You can also lessen headaches and avoid the trouble of seed germination and sexing plants by starting with clones.
A clone is a cutting that is genetically similar to the plant it was taken fromthat plant is understood as the "mom." Through cloning, you can produce a new harvest with precise replicas of your preferred plant. Due to the fact that genes are identical, a clone will offer you a plant with the exact same attributes as the mom, such as flavor, cannabinoid profile, yield, grow time, etc. So if you discover a specific stress or phenotype you truly like, you may want to clone it to recreate more buds that have the very same effects and qualities. With cloning, you don't need to get new seeds whenever you wish to grow another plantyou simply take a cutting of the old plantand you do not need to sprout seeds or sex them out and get rid of the males. feminized seeds usa.
Another drawback to clones is they can take on unfavorable traits from the mother plant also. If the mother has a disease, draws in insects, or grows weak branches, its clones will most likely have the exact same concerns. Additionally, every veteran grower will tell you that clones break down over time - how to make feminized seeds. Feminized cannabis seeds will produce only female plants for getting buds, so there is no requirement to get rid of males or worry about female plants getting pollinated. Feminized seeds are produced by triggering the monoecious condition in a female cannabis plantthe resulting seeds are nearly similar to the self-pollinated female moms and dad, as just one set of genes exists.
This is achieved through numerous methods: By spraying the plant with a solution of colloidal silver, a liquid consisting of tiny particles of silver, Through a method called rodelization, in which a female plant pushed past maturity can pollinate another woman, Spraying seeds with gibberellic acid, a hormone that sets off germination (this is much less common) Most experienced or industrial growers will not use feminized seeds due to the fact that they just include one set of genes, and these should never ever be utilized for breeding functions - feminized cannabis seeds. Nevertheless, a lot of starting growers begin with feminized seeds since they eliminate the concern of needing to deal with male plants.

They are easy to grow since you don't need to worry about light cycles and how much light a plant receives. Many marijuana plants begin blooming when the quantity of light they receive every day reduces. Outdoors, this occurs when the sun begins setting previously in the day as the season turns from summer season to autumn. Indoor growers can control when a plant flowers by reducing the daily amount of light plants get from 18 hours to 12 hours - autoflower feminized seeds.
Autoflowers can be begun in early spring and will flower during the longest days of summer season, making the most of high quality light to grow yields. Or, if you get a late start in the growing season, you can begin autoflowers in May or June and harvest in the fall (autoflowering seeds for sale). Also, autoflower plants are smallperfect for closet grows or any small grow, or growing outdoors where you don't want your neighbors to see what you're up to. A couple huge downsides, though: Autoflower pressures are known for being less potent. Also, since they are small in stature, they typically don't produce big yields.

CBD, or cannabidiol, is among the chemical componentsknown collectively as cannabinoidsfound in the marijuana plant. Over the years, humans have chosen plants for high-THC material, making cannabis with high levels of CBD unusual. The hereditary pathways through which THC is synthesized by the plant are various than those for CBD production. Marijuana used for hemp production has been selected for other traits, including a low THC material, so regarding abide by the 2018 Farm Costs.
As interest in CBD as a medicine has actually grown, lots of breeders have actually crossed high-CBD hemp with marijuana. These stress have little or no THC, 1:1 ratios of THC and CBD, or some have a high-THC content together with considerable quantities of CBD (3% or more). Seeds for these varieties are now commonly offered online and through dispensaries. It must be kept in mind, however, that any plant grown from these seeds is not ensured to produce high levels of CBD, as it takes numerous years to create a seed line that produces consistent outcomes - best feminized seeds. A grower wanting to produce cannabis with a particular THC to CBD ratio will need to grow from a checked and shown clone or seed.

Cannabis seeds require three things to sprout: water, heat, and air. There are numerous techniques to germinate seeds, however for the most typical and simplest technique, you will require: 2 clean plates, Four paper towels, Seeds, Distilled water Take four sheets of paper towels and soak them with pure water. The towels must be soaked but shouldn't have excess water running off.
Then, put the cannabis seeds at least an inch apart from each other and cover them with the remaining 2 water-soaked paper towels. To develop a dark, secured space, take another plate and turn it over to cover the seeds, like a dome. Make certain the area the seeds remain in is warm, somewhere between 70-85F. After finishing these steps, it's time to wait. Examine the paper towels when a day to ensure they're still saturated, and if they are losing moisture, use more water to keep the seeds pleased - autoflowering cannabis seeds. Some seeds germinate very rapidly while others can take a while, but usually, seeds need to sprout in 3-10 days.
A seed has actually sprouted when the seed divides and a single sprout appears. The grow is the taproot, which will become the main stem of the plant, and seeing it suggests successful germination. It is essential to keep the delicate seed sterilized, so do not touch the seed or taproot as it starts to divide. As soon as you see the taproot, it's time to move your sprouted seed into its growing medium, such as soil. feminized cannabis seeds. Fill a 4-inch or one-gallon pot with loose, airy potting soil, Water the soil before you put the seed in; it should be damp but not soaked, Poke a hole in the soil with a pen or pencilthe general rule is: make the hole twice as deep as the seed is large, Utilizing a set of tweezers, carefully put the seed in the hole with the taproot dealing with down, Gently cover it with soil Keep a close eye on the temperature level and wetness level of the soil to keep the seed happy.
